    The Adidas Split: A Turning Point

    The Adidas partnership was a cornerstone of Kanye West's (Ye's) fashion empire, particularly the Yeezy line. This collaboration produced some of the most iconic and sought-after sneakers in recent history, blending Adidas's athletic expertise with Ye's avant-garde design sensibilities. However, the relationship began to unravel due to Ye's controversial remarks and public behavior, which Adidas deemed unacceptable and damaging to their brand. The decision to terminate the partnership was a monumental blow, given the Yeezy line's significant contribution to Adidas's revenue and brand image. Cutting ties meant not only losing a major revenue stream but also dealing with the logistical nightmare of unsold Yeezy inventory.

    Following the split, Adidas faced the challenge of what to do with millions of dollars worth of Yeezy products. Burning the inventory was considered but deemed environmentally irresponsible. Ultimately, Adidas decided to sell the existing Yeezy stock, donating a portion of the proceeds to charity. This move allowed them to recoup some of the lost revenue while also making a positive social impact. Meanwhile, Ye was left to navigate the future of the Yeezy brand independently. The split forced him to rethink his business strategy and explore new avenues for his creative vision. This separation marked a significant turning point, highlighting the precarious nature of relying heavily on a single partnership and the importance of maintaining positive brand associations. The Adidas split not only impacted Ye's financial standing but also his reputation and future prospects in the fashion industry. This event served as a stark reminder of the intersection between personal conduct and business success.

    Gap's Departure: Another Major Blow

    Following the Adidas fallout, another significant blow to Kanye West's (Ye's) business empire came with the termination of his partnership with Gap. The Yeezy Gap line, launched with much fanfare, aimed to bring Ye's unique design aesthetic to a broader audience through more accessible and affordable clothing. However, the collaboration quickly ran into issues, with Ye publicly criticizing Gap for not fulfilling its promises regarding distribution, pricing, and creative control. He felt that Gap was not fully embracing his vision and was hindering the potential success of the Yeezy Gap line. These public disagreements created tension and strained the relationship between Ye and Gap's management.

    Ultimately, Ye decided to end the partnership, citing breaches of contract and unfulfilled commitments. The departure from Gap left a void in his fashion endeavors and raised questions about his ability to maintain stable and productive collaborations with major corporations. The Yeezy Gap line had shown promise, but the inability to align visions and execute plans effectively led to its demise. This event underscored the challenges of balancing creative vision with the practical realities of the business world. It also highlighted the importance of clear communication, mutual respect, and shared goals in any successful partnership. The end of the Gap collaboration further contributed to the slowdown of Ye's family business, reinforcing the need for a more sustainable and collaborative approach to his future ventures.
